Two killed, over 100 families displaced as three dams overflow in Narok

Some of the houses that were submerged by the flood waters at Nairagie Enkare in Narok East Sub-County. (Robert Kiplagat, Standard)

Two people killed and over 100 families displaced after three dams overflowed submerging the entire village in Nairagie Enkare area in Narok East Sub-County following the ongoing heavy rains pounding the area.

The raging flood waters engulfed a total of five churches, destroyed tens of acres under maize, bean and banana plantation forcing the residents to flee their homes to safer grounds.
